Bookwalker is a digital bookstore, no physical copies to be had here.

It's also how I posted those obscenely large scans from Dengeki PS 572 last week at 2560x1600 resolution.

And yes, you will get your codes with bookwalker as well. Click on "My Page/マイページ" drop down menu, then "Purchase Bonus/購入特典" in the upper right corner. This should take you to a page with all your codes. Far easier than that paper packet that's bound into the spine they ask you to cut out.

You would need a new account for more codes. Also be warned; a few months ago Sega updated the PSO2 ToS so that you can't actually use one particular type of bonus code more than once on your account (e.g. You can't use the Moment Gale code twice on your account, even if you have 2 different codes). The reason is to eliminate RMT and unfair advantages. The exception of course will be any kuji drawings they hold, where the point is to buy more codes.

Most recent case of this are the Danbo Suit and Mag codes that were handed out at the Arks GP finale - they just posted a statement saying anyone who used more than 1 code (and it also says this clearly on the card that you can't have more than one, seeing as you shouldn't have more than one card anyway) are going to be handed a temp ban, and to consider that the final warning, as another infraction will lead to indefinite account suspension.
